Output 96be63df7923a1e16390293198216ed9598896f41d7e9b6369c4f4fd6c5b6dc5:0

value
766457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b8f770cf3af0753241296856a99bc62a34a707 OP_EQUAL
address
3NpFbZN9nboQZMePEJc5sRSD38v1VUtrhn
transaction
96be63df7923a1e16390293198216ed9598896f41d7e9b6369c4f4fd6c5b6dc5
confirmations
248339
spent
true